Safety

Treadmills can be beneficial and safe exercise equipment when used correctly however, they can be dangerous or even deadly machines if they are not treated with the highest degree of care. Treadmill injuries are common, and they are usually caused by entrapment accidents or falls. The most serious injuries involving treadmills can cause severe friction burns that may require multiple skin grafts, and in the worst-case scenario, result in death.

The safety of a treadmill is heavily on the type of treadmill you are using. Manual treadmills can be safer because they do not require motors or complex electronics. However, they can also be less durable and require more maintenance than electric treadmills. In addition, the majority of manual treadmills don't have pre-programmed workouts, as well as other features found on electric treadmills.

Electric treadmills are a more secure alternative. They use powerful electric motors to create regular rotations of the treadmill electric vs manual belt making it much easier to run or walk. They also have advanced safety features, including deceleration control that can help you slow down and prevent injury if you accidentally lose your footing. The majority of treadmills include a safety lock that you can attach to your clothing, which will disable the treadmill's motor in case of a fall or other emergency.

If you purchase an electric treadmill, it's crucial to place it on a separate circuit. This will ensure that it gets the power it requires, and that it doesn't cause electrical issues in the future. If you don't own an exclusive circuit, it's essential to limit other appliances such as lamps, lights, or other devices on the same circuit.

Convenience

Electric treadmills are much more convenient than manual treadmills. The latest features include touchscreens, Bluetooth FTMS built-in and integration with fitness applications. Other useful features that are available in a variety of models include built-in speakers, fans and USB ports. These features make them ideal for working out in shared spaces like apartments or office gyms. In addition, their motors are quieter than those of manual treadmills, and are more suitable for use by those who prefer to exercise at a lower volume.

These upgraded features may seem appealing but they come at more cost, which makes them prohibitive for those on the budget for. The price differences between these two kinds are also crucial in the process of deciding because they can help people determine which provides the best value for money.

Manual treadmills place less strain on the joints as they are solely reliant on the user's efforts to move the belt. This could be a beneficial feature for those with any concerns about joint health, as they can exercise without risking injury to their knees or ankles. However, the absence of a motor could cause less consistent pacing and could pose a challenge for some runners who want to improve their running form or improve their technique.

In addition manual treadmills aren't a good choice for endurance training as they do not provide the capability of building speed. This could pose a safety issue for those preparing for marathons or other long-distance events. Many electric treadmills, on the other hand, offer a variety of speeds and incline levels to assist runners in reaching their goals and prepare for races.

Weight Loss

Treadmills can help you shed weight by permitting you to walk at a leisurely pace while keeping track of your distance and calories burned. Treadmills can also be utilized to add running to your workout, but without being hampered by outdoor conditions like weather or lack of safe places to run. Treadmills let you regulate the speed and the incline. This can be a great way to challenge yourself and build endurance.

They might cost more initially, but if they're properly maintained and lubricated, they can provide long-term value. These treadmills may have additional features that make working out more enjoyable and enjoyable. They're a great investment for anyone who wants to build muscle or maintain fitness.

A lot of treadmills with electric motors come with pre-set exercises that can help you reach your goals. These programs typically consist of short workouts, like intervals for jogging and recovery which are then incorporated into a complete program that includes an incline and speed that is alternating. This will help you reach your fitness goals and reduce the risk of injury.

You can also create your own calorie goals and alter the treadmill settings to meet it. For example, if you want to burn more calories during a session you can set the speed and incline at a comfortable pace and track your progress on a phone or fitness app. This will keep you on track and accountable for your goals, while also ensuring you get the most benefit from every treadmill session. After every exercise, take a few moments to stretch and cool down. This can reduce the risk of injury.

Endurance Training

For athletes training for endurance treadmills are a great method to build up your fitness for long-distance runners and increase stamina. You can jog or run comfortably for longer workouts, without causing injury or burning your muscles.

Some treadmills also offer the ability to adjust the incline which can provide an extra challenge to your workout and assist you to build leg strength. However, runners might want to do some of their endurance training outdoors to have an increased chance of working on natural running form and mechanics.

The best electric treadmills for sale treadmills will be versatile enough to accommodate a variety of fitness needs. The best treadmills for running will offer a range of incline and speed settings that can be used for running, walking or jogging at a faster pace. Certain machines come with preset programs that allow you to alter the speed and incline for an even more intense exercise.

While some treadmills that are electric are more expensive than manual treadmills however, they can be worth the cost for those who are serious about their fitness goals. Look for features like a durable belt and a quiet motor. You should also consider the cushioning of the treadmill, as it is crucial to avoid excessive bounce that could lead to injury.
